Lanarkshire Conservative politicians Meghan Gallacher and Graham Simpson have condemned local homelessness levels as “scandalous” following data showing a surge in homelessness applications in Scotland, reaching a peak not seen since 2011-12. Last year, 40,685 households were assessed as homeless or at risk of homelessness, while the number of children in temporary accommodation also hit record highs, reflecting a growing crisis in the region.

Soldier who raped stranger in ‘harrowing’ street attack jailed for nine years
A soldier who tried to hide in a railway station cubicle after raping a stranger in a doorway in a ‘harrowing’ attack has been jailed for nine years. Private John Harvey, 25, confessed to police after attacking a young woman in Shrewsbury, but later pleaded not guilty, forcing her to testify during a nine-day trial.
